- Reach, Teach and Touch – 3 Requirements for Any Presenter
Selling your idea isn’t easy. Listeners are inundated with information all day long. Additionally, they are often doing the job of several people and, consequently, are consumed with their own issues and tasks. To get your message remembered over others, you must Reach, Teach and Touch.

- Service Has a Feeling
People who rave about the service they receive from an organization expect more than the resolution of a problem. They want to “feel” valued as a customer and to be given special treatment.
